So apparently Animal Crossing Wii is finally going to be announced soon. This is awesome.

Stuff I want:
* More personality types for the villagers than just the six from the last few games.
* Lots of motion controls for stuff like fishing and butterfly catching.
* A flower/plant section of the museum to open.
* Bring back some of the landmarks from the GameCube game - the Police Station, Fountain, Island, Lighthouse, and Dump. Just for variety's sake. Split the cafe into it's own building too and give you the option to work there
* Connectivity with the DS version so I can port over my Bells and house and expand it further. And the return of the basement.
* Return of Holidays, decent ones.
* Maybe the ability to keep a simple, Nintendog-style pet or maintain your own personal aquarium or terrarium.
* More visitors to the village.
* The ability to have a more detailed garden and decorate the outside of your house.
* A wifi auction house were people can trade items for bells or vice versa.
* More errands and ways to make money.
* Some "event plots" that are little quests that happen randomly. Like fixing up town after an earthquake or a dinosaur visiting the village or some cool stuff like that.
* Easier management over who lives in your town and who is kicked out or moves away. Such as buying the deeds to the other house in the village so you don't get a village full of bitchy cats.
* More stuff to collect, like a jewel and rock collection, stamps, coins, and trading cards.
* An expanded town square with a little market where the characters gather more.
* More dialog for all of the characters.
* An album of all of the items you've collected and all of the characters who have lived in your village and a little paragraph on each that can be accessed at any time.
* Greater variety of plants.
* Areas around the village to explore. A farm, a mountain, a beach, a cave, and a forest.

Thank Christ for you guys. I hate Animal Crossing and everynoe else convinced me I was crazy for it. I got the DS version based on everyone I know's high recommendation, but couldn't stomach it. I just didn't enjoy a game that bitched me out for not being around, but made me just sit around doing the video game equivalent of busywork. Not fun busywork, like No More Heroes, which even managed to make lawn mowing mildly entertaining. I figured they were just having a blast with the fake social network and taking it seriously.

I figured I'd give the multiplayer a shot, to find all my friends' towns had vulgar and deprecatory memos posted on the bulletin board. This isn't something I'd have had a problem with doing myself, but if you acknowledge the towngoers as thoughtless cardboard cutouts, then what else is left? It's basically a physical manifestation of MySpace. Sure people are talking to you, but they're programmed by someone who doesn't even care if you exist, and they don't even hide it. And there's really not that much to do past that.
